Hi,
Having an issue that whenver I merge data in Query Editor from 2 sources (Salesforce & local Datawarehouse, or Sharepoint & local Datawarehouse) I am unable to refresh in Service, and consequently Schedule Refresh. I have no problems refreshing the data within desktop.
My only fix right now is:
I have to go to View > Query Dependencies and isolate the queries that are built using 2 sources, and rebuild their relationships in the DAX environment.
I read that this may be an issue with sources requiring OAuth2 credentials, can anyone verify? I'm not using the On-Premises Data Gateway, but rather one configured by IT.

Hi there
Could you confirm what the privacy settings are set to?
I would suggest turning them off.
And then also ensuring that the privacy settings for the data sources on the Gateway are set to none?
Also ensure that the data sources in the Gateway match what you have in your Power BI Desktop file. You can view them by clicking on Edit Queries, then Data Sources
